A UN Security Council report has implicated Jaish-e-Mohammed in a car bombing near Delhi’s Red Fort last November, which claimed 15 lives. The outfit’s leader, Masood Azhar, reportedly established a women’s wing to aid terror attacks. Investigations into the incident revealed a ‘white-collar’ terror module, leading to several arrests.
